Neeraj Chopra finished second in the Lausanne Diamond League with a season-best javelin throw of 88.05 metres on August 23, 2026.
Sri Lanka’s Rumesh Tharanga Pathirage won the event with a throw of 88.14 metres, edging out the two-time Olympic medallist by just nine centimetres.
This performance marks a return to the 88-metre range for Chopra, who has been seeking his first victory since the Neeraj Chopra Classic in July 2025.
